Spanikopita pizza is delicious⦠its spanikopita filling on a pizza⦠soā¦
Garlic Butter and Parmesean on the crustā¦then you add spanikopita filling(mixture of ricotta, feta, egg, lots of garlic,diced red onion) You mix it all together and put it on top and then top with parmesean and mozzerella cheese.
Spanikopita is greek for spinach pie. So very garlicy and spinach"y".

Iāve never seen it but then Iām in Atlanta. In Germany, my host mom used to make me āMilchreisā. Arborio rice simmered in whole milk and sugar until creamy. Served with fresh whipped cream and strawberries. (Iām making myself miss it.)
